Comparison Summary

1. Specifications Comparison

Design

FeatureSamsung Galaxy S20 FE 5GSamsung Galaxy A23 5GPractical Impact
Physical Size159.8 × 74.5 × 8.4 mm165.4 × 76.9 × 8.4 mmA23 5G is taller and wider, slightly less comfortable for one-handed use, especially for smaller hands.
Weight190g197gS20 FE 5G is slightly lighter, making it more comfortable to hold for extended periods.
Build Quality (Screen Protection)Corning Gorilla Glass 3Corning Gorilla Glass 5A23 5G's screen is more resistant to scratches and cracks from accidental drops.

Display

FeatureSamsung Galaxy S20 FE 5GSamsung Galaxy A23 5GPractical Impact
Size6.5"6.6"Negligible difference in screen size; both offer ample screen real estate.
Resolution1080x24001080x2408Virtually identical sharpness; no discernible difference to the human eye.
Pixel Density407 PPI400 PPISimilar pixel density, both considered sharp.
TechnologyAMOLEDPLS LCDS20 FE 5G has superior contrast, color vibrancy, and power efficiency, leading to a richer viewing experience, especially in dark mode.
Refresh Rate120Hz120HzBoth offer smooth scrolling and animations, making the user interface feel more responsive.
Brightness1200 nits0 nitsS20 FE 5G is significantly brighter, offering much better visibility in direct sunlight. A23 5G having 0 nits is likely a data entry error as it would be completely unusable. In reality, it would be much lower than the S20 FE 5G.

Performance

FeatureSamsung Galaxy S20 FE 5GSamsung Galaxy A23 5GPractical Impact
ChipsetQualcomm Snapdragon 865 5G (7 nm+)Qualcomm Snapdragon 695 5G (6 nm)S20 FE 5G's chipset offers significantly faster performance for demanding tasks like gaming, video editing, and multitasking.
AnTuTu Score623,000418,000The S20 FE 5G provides a smoother and more responsive user experience, particularly with resource-intensive applications.
GPUAdreno 650Adreno 619S20 FE 5G's GPU provides superior graphics performance for gaming and other graphically intensive tasks.

Camera

FeatureSamsung Galaxy S20 FE 5GSamsung Galaxy A23 5GPractical Impact
Main Camera Resolution12MP50MPA23 5G captures more detailed images in good lighting conditions, but the S20 FE 5G's larger sensor may offer better low-light performance.
Main Camera Sensor Size1/1.76"1/2.76"S20 FE 5G gathers more light, resulting in better low-light photos and shallower depth of field.
Selfie Camera Resolution32MP8MPS20 FE 5G captures significantly more detailed selfies.
Telephoto LensYes (8MP)NoS20 FE 5G offers optical zoom capabilities for better zoomed-in photos.
Ultra-Wide LensYes (12MP)Yes (5MP)S20 FE 5G captures wider scenes with better quality.
Macro LensNoYes (2MP)A23 5G can take close-up photos of small objects.
Portrait Mode (Depth)NoYes (2MP)A23 5G provides additional hardware support for portrait mode.
Video RecordingUp to 4K@60fpsUp to 1080p@30fpsS20 FE 5G captures higher-resolution, smoother videos.
Optical Image Stabilization (OIS)YesYesBoth phones are able to reduce blur from shaky hands or movement during recording.

Battery

FeatureSamsung Galaxy S20 FE 5GSamsung Galaxy A23 5GPractical Impact
Capacity4500mAh5000mAhA23 5G offers longer battery life, potentially lasting a full day or more for moderate users.
Charging25W Fast Charging25W Fast ChargingBoth phones charge relatively quickly.
Wireless ChargingYes (15W)NoS20 FE 5G offers convenient wireless charging, eliminating the need for cables.
Reverse Wireless ChargingYes (4.5W)NoS20 FE 5G can wirelessly charge other devices, like earbuds or smartwatches.
Bypass ChargingNoYesA23 5G can directly power the system when plugged in, reducing heat during gaming or heavy tasks.

Storage

FeatureSamsung Galaxy S20 FE 5GSamsung Galaxy A23 5GPractical Impact
Internal Storage128GB or 256GBN/AS20 FE 5G offers significantly more built-in storage for apps, photos, videos, and files.
RAM6GB or 8GBN/AS20 FE 5G provides smoother multitasking and better app performance.
Expandable StorageNoNoNeither phone allows users to add more storage via microSD card.

Connectivity

FeatureSamsung Galaxy S20 FE 5GSamsung Galaxy A23 5GPractical Impact
Wi-FiWi-Fi 6 (802.11ax)Wi-Fi 5 (802.11ac)S20 FE 5G has faster and more efficient Wi-Fi, especially on newer routers.
Bluetooth5.05.1A23 5G has slightly improved Bluetooth connectivity, but the practical difference is minimal.
SIMDual SIMSingle SIMS20 FE 5G allows use of two SIM cards simultaneously, useful for separating personal and work lines or using a local SIM when traveling.

2. Key Differences Analysis

Samsung Galaxy S20 FE 5G Advantages:

  • Superior Display: AMOLED screen offers vibrant colors, deep blacks, and better power efficiency. Much higher brightness.
  • Significantly Faster Performance: Snapdragon 865 provides a much smoother and more responsive experience for gaming, multitasking, and demanding apps.
  • Better Camera System: Offers a telephoto lens, higher-quality ultra-wide lens, and significantly better selfie camera. Supports 4K video recording at 60fps.
  • Wireless Charging and Reverse Wireless Charging: Adds convenience and allows charging other devices.
  • More Internal Storage and RAM: Provides more space for files and smoother multitasking.
  • Dual SIM Support: Useful for managing multiple phone numbers.
  • Better Audio: Enhanced spatial audio due to Dolby Atmos and Stereo speakers.

Practical Implications:

  • The S20 FE 5G is a better choice for users who prioritize display quality, performance, camera capabilities, and convenience features like wireless charging. It's well-suited for gaming, photography, and media consumption.

Samsung Galaxy A23 5G Advantages:

  • Larger Battery: Offers longer battery life, suitable for users who need all-day or multi-day power.
  • More Recent Software: Ships with a newer version of Android and has guaranteed longer software support.
  • Macro Lens and Depth Sensor: Offers increased versatility for close-up photography and enhanced depth of field.
  • Corning Gorilla Glass 5: Offers slightly better scratch resistance for the screen.
  • Bypass Charging: Reduces heat when charging while gaming.
  • Ultrasonic proximity virtual and Barometer sensors

Practical Implications:

  • The A23 5G is better for users who prioritize battery life, the latest software features, and the additional flexibility of macro and depth sensors.

Significant Trade-offs:

  • Choosing the S20 FE 5G means sacrificing longer battery life and a macro lens.
  • Choosing the A23 5G means sacrificing display quality, performance, a telephoto lens, wireless charging, and potentially a smoother overall experience.
